Birmingham Alabama
Birminghams checkered past has earned it the nickname Bombingham due to racial unrest in the 60s, and an industrial economy inspired another unappealing nickname, The Pittsburgh of the South. However today Birmingham has a surprising amount of culture to offer, and has claimed its civil rights struggle with a new nickname: Diverse City. Population: 212,237 according to the 2010 Census.
Climate: Birmingham has hot summers, mild winters, and abundant rainfall - 59 inches of rain per year to be precise. No snow, however.
Cost of living: Retirement incomes go farther where the cost of living is 13% less than the national average.
Housing costs: Even more affordable are retirement homes which average 54% less than the national average. The median home cost in Birmingham is unbelievably low at $89,700.
Colleges and Universities: Jefferson State College has a division called Adult Studies which will probably include courses of interest to lifelong learners. And of course there are a myriad of offerings at the University of Alabama.
Transportation:Birmingham-Jefferson County Transit Authority runs a public bus system for the metro area. Birmingham-Shuttlesworth International Airport serves more than 3 million passengers every year.
Travel and tourism: Birmingham has four interesting neighborhoods to explore: Five Points, near the University of Alabama Birmingham; Lakeview, home to one of the Souths greatest bars; Homewood, an upscale shopping strip with a pedestrian-friendly layout and a small-town vibe; and the Civil Rights District, an unforgettable cluster of attractions at the edge of downtown.
